Koottukad
Village in Kerala, India
10°10′0″N 76°13′0″E / 10.16667°N 76.21667°E / 10.16667; 76.21667Koottukad is a small village in Parur Taluk, Ernakulam district of Kerala state, South India. It is about 25 km from Ernakulam town. It has a large expanses of green plain.
The famous church named Little Flower church is situated here. The people in this greenish place are very friendly as the name denotes. A small LP School named Santa cruz Lp school - having 85 years of past memories - is in this place.
The beautiful Cherai beach is only 8 km from this place.
